The term moderate evolution might therefore be applied to a theory which simply inquires into the biological reality of man in accordance with the formal object of the biological sciences as defined
by their methods and which affirms a real genetic connection between that human biological reality and the
animal kingdom, but which also in accordance with the fundamental methodological principles of those sciences, can not and does not attempt to assert that it has made a statement adequate to the whole reality of man and to the
origin of this whole reality.

Endosymbiotic theory, that attempts to explain the
origins of eukaryotic cell organelles such as mitochondria in
animals and fungi and chloroplasts in plants was greatly advanced
by the seminal work of biologist Lynn Margulis in the 1960s.
Comparative analysis enabled
by the sequencing of the sponge genome reveals genomic events linked to the
origin and early evolution of
animals, including the appearance, expansion and diversification of pan-metazoan transcription factor, signalling pathway and structural genes.
